Why Cleanliness Matters More During Peak Season
Peak season amplifies every strength and exposes every weakness in a facility. When foot traffic, forklift movement, and product volume all increase, dust, debris, and spills accumulate faster. Without a structured approach to Warehouse Cleaning, aisles become cluttered, pick paths slow down, and safety risks multiply. A clean warehouse supports:
Safety: Clear aisles, dry floors, and well-maintained restrooms help reduce slips, trips, and OSHA-reportable incidents.
Productivity: Workers move faster and pick more accurately in an orderly, uncluttered environment.
Professional image: Carriers, clients, and auditors form immediate impressions based on visible cleanliness and organization.
For businesses that rely on just‑in‑time fulfillment, a neglected cleaning program can quickly turn into equipment downtime, order errors, and employee injuries—exactly when you can least afford them.
Build a Peak Season Maintenance Plan Around Cleaning
Effective Peak Season Maintenance is about more than servicing conveyors and forklifts. It also includes the cleaning routines that protect those assets and keep the facility running. A practical plan usually covers three time horizons:
Daily tasks: Floor sweeping and scrubbing, trash removal, restroom sanitation, breakroom cleaning, and high‑touch surface disinfection in offices and shipping areas.
Weekly tasks: Dusting racking and equipment, cleaning loading dock areas, detailing entryways, and addressing recurring problem zones such as packing stations.
Periodic deep cleaning: Machine scrub of hard floors, restroom deep cleaning, breakroom appliance cleaning, and targeted Industrial Hygiene measures based on your risk profile.

Industrial Hygiene: Protecting People, Not Just Floors
Industrial Hygiene focuses on identifying and controlling environmental factors that may affect worker health. In a warehouse, that includes dust, chemical residues, airflow, and high‑touch surfaces shared by multiple shifts. During peak season, extended operating hours and temporary staff can increase exposure if controls are not in place.
A strong hygiene‑focused approach to Warehouse Cleaning should address:
Regular cleaning and disinfection of shared equipment such as RF scanners, pallet jacks, workstations, and time clocks.
Dust control on high shelves, beams, and overhead surfaces that can affect air quality and sensitive products.
Restroom and locker room sanitation that keeps up with increased shift counts and overtime.

Practical Cleaning Strategies for Busy Warehouse Operations
When time is tight, Cleaning Strategies must be realistic, repeatable, and integrated into the flow of work. Consider the following approaches as you plan for peak season:
Zone-based cleaning: Divide the warehouse into clear zones—receiving, bulk storage, pick modules, packing, shipping, offices, and restrooms—and assign specific cleaning frequencies and responsibilities to each.
Clean-as-you-go expectations: Build simple housekeeping tasks into standard work instructions, such as clearing discarded packaging, wiping surfaces, and returning tools to designated locations at the end of each shift.
Strategic timing: Schedule machine floor scrubbing, restroom deep cleans, and high‑dusting for low‑traffic windows to avoid disrupting production while still maintaining standards.
Visual standards: Use simple signage and checklists at docks, breakrooms, and packing stations so staff and supervisors can quickly see whether cleaning tasks have been completed.
